Q1 A metal sphere of radius R is charged to a potential V.
(a) Find the electrostatic energy stored in the electric field within a concentric sphere of radius 2R.
(b) Show that the electrostatic field energy stored outside the sphere of radius 2R equals that stored within it. 
 
 
Q2 A large conducting plane has a surface charge density 1.0 * 10-4 C/m2  
Find the electrostatic energy stored in a cubical volume of edge 1.0 cm in front of the plane.

use the concept that energy density i.e energy stored per unit volume in electric field is given by

= (1/2) x permittivity x (Electric field intensity)^2
